Matt Angle work experience

A career timeline built from the work history available for this profile.

Co-Owner

Majr Mechatronics, Llc

https://majrmech.com

Mar 2018 - Mar 2022

Electronics

Mit Event

Electronics design, layout, and production for MIT eVent project - open source ventilators for the developing world and domestic COVID response.

Apr 2020 - Mar 2021

Postdoctoral Associate

Cambridge, Ma, Us

Industrial Cybersecuirty and Electric Machines for Transportation Applications. Used knowledge of electric machinery and control hardware to devise novel attacks on infrastructure. Designed, built, and tested switched-flux and surface-mount permanent-magnet electric machines.

Dec 2015 - Dec 2017

Ph.D. Candidate

Cambridge, Ma, Us

Developed a novel modeling method for surface mount permanent magnet brushless DC machines. Faster computation times and improved accuracy result in the ability to design by brute-force methods. Work is funded by the DARPA M3 program and motors are used in the MIT Robotic Cheetah in the Biomimetics Lab. Past projects include MVDC breakers, hydrostatic bearings, solar-tracking schemes for solar energy, offshore drilling and blowout containment devices, and collision avoidance for autonomous naval vehicles.

Jun 2011 - Dec 2015

Technical Consultant

Marina Del Rey, California, Us

Designed, programmed, debugged, and tested all prototype electronics hardware culminating in $10M Series-A funding round. Responsible for architecture and execution of prototype electronics, including a large ultrasonic phased-array transmitter, piezo energy harvesting receiver, optical tracking system, and beamforming algorithm.

Jun 2012 - Apr 2015

Technical Consultant

Developed embedded control system for the Mule II platform, a ~50-hp, 300 lb, hybrid-electric, tracked vehicle intended for military use. Technical areas include Lithium-Ion battery management, engine control, electrical system architecture, various intelligent navigation schemes, and general electronics hacking.

Apr 2012 - Apr 2014

Engineer

Colorado Springs, Co, Us

Worked in the Concept Engineering Group. Primary client was the Missile Defense Agency. Tasks included system analysis, high-level-concept design, and modeling, simulation, and detailed design of concepts and individual subsystems. Concepts ranged from sensors to sensor platforms to missile systems to directed energy weapons. Design work included detailed guidance, optical, electrical, and thermal system design of hardware that has been proven on the test stand.

Apr 2006 - Jun 2013

Technical Consultant

X Energy

Modeled and simulated a small, modular nuclear plant. Most work was performed in MATLAB Simulink. Tasks included modeling of turbomachinery, electric machinery, and heat exchangers. Models were then incorporated in a system model to simulate and develop control schemes for plant dynamics, as well as to optimize steady-state performance.

Jan 2011 - Jun 2011
